Yes. I bought this almost two years ago, and back then I was stuck benching 165 with serious pain... now I'm around 275 and zero issues. It takes a couple session for your wrists stablizers to adapt, but after that, it feels much more natural than using a straight bar.
I do use interchangeably for OHP, you just have to tilt your head back a little more to not hit yourself, but it's fine. For some reason I don't have shoulder issues with OHP, just bench.
I also use it for hammer curls, front raises, and skullcrushers.

04-13-2015, 07:21 AM #2370
I have to say this one of the best tools for eating clean, especially when you work a lot. I usually live off of chicken breast, turkey patties, and fish, but I don't like having to stand next to a stove to cook it. With this bad boy I can just toss the meat in, put some seasoning on, set a timer, and go watch tv. Rinse and repeat until I have my meals cooked for the week.
